  • This study was made on the poly(vinyl acetate) (PVAc) and poly(vinyl acetate- ethylene) (VAE) emulsion polymer blend which used PVA as protective colloid, and the PVA used as protective colloid was existed in each emulsion film before blend and even in the film after the blend consecutively. It makes us expect excellent adhesive power among particles that form the blend. Emulsion blends with different Tg are important target of concerning, and PVAc/VAE emulsion blend suggested simple and excellent research method. As a result of blend, elongation was lowered by the increase of PVAc, and the plasticizer used in making PVAc affected on the Tg of blend and lowered Tg of VAE emulsion, and the synergy effect of two blends was seen for the tensile strength, thermal resistance, and adhesive strength.

  • The cosmetic industry is technology-intensive in the field of fine chemistry and continues to grow globally. The functional aspects have been mainly emphasized in the past to increase the market share in these cosmetics industries. Recently, however, efforts have been made to attract the attention of consumers to the visual effects as well as the excellent performance of cosmetics at home and abroad. Accordingly, cosmetic manufacturers are trying various technologies that encapsulate the cosmetic emulsion and modify the shape, color, and texture of the emulsion capsule. The basic and easiest method of encapsulating emulsion is dropping the emulsion through the nozzle from emulsion storage. On the other hand, the existing method of encapsulating emulsion has a limit in reducing the size of the capsule. In this study, the limit was shown by theory and numerical analysis method, and the emulsion encapsulation phenomena occurring in the micro-channel were studied to apply microfluidics as an alternative.

  • When emulsion explosives(1kg/cartridge) are loaded into a long vertical borehole at open blasting site, they undergo an Impact corresponding to 117.6J of shock energy. After shocking. the crystallization of emulsion nay happen immediately. Furthermore, it nay cause a desensitization, arising from increase in the density of emulsion explosive by the breakage of sensitizer. In this paper, some experimental work was performed using PVC pipe equipment(50mm diameter and 12m lengths) to investigate the effects of loading impart of emulsion explosive. It is shown that detonation energy decreases up to 26% of the normal state value and this effect is less than 3% of the total performance of emulsion explosives in borehole blasting.

  • 암반발파에 사용하고 있는 전기식 뇌관과 비전기식 연결뇌관 및 번치 커넥터(Bunch connector), 점화구, 에멀젼류 폭약이 지상에서 기폭 될 때 발생하는 소음을 비교 분석하였다. 에멀젼류 폭약의 폭발소음과 화공품의 기폭소음에 대한 추정식을 도출하였다. 에멀젼류 폭약의 폭발 소음 예측은 반대수 자승근 환산식, 번치 커넥터, 전기식 뇌관 및 비전기식 연결뇌관 및 점화구는 전대수식이 적합한 것으로 판단된다. 소음원으로부터 동일한 거리에서의 소음은 점화구, 비전기식 연결뇌관, 전기식 뇌관 및 번치 커넥터 순으로 높았다. 소음원으로부터 약20∼30m거리의 범위에서 번치 커넥터의 기폭소음은 에멀젼류 폭약 0.250kg의 폭발소음보다 약15.6∼20.2dB(A) 낮고, 비전기식 연결뇌관 보다 약13.5∼16.0dB(A) 높고, 전기식 뇌관 보다는 약6.5∼7.5dB(A) 높게 됨을 알 수 있었다. 점화구는 약20m 거리에서 약 7dB(A)이하 이었다. 에멀젼류 폭약의 폭발과 번치 커넥터의 기폭소음에 미치는 주(主)소음원은 에멀젼류 폭약의 약량과 번치 커넥터의 도폭선임을 확인하였다.

  • IIn this study, O/W type nano-emulsions were prepared by phospholipid-nonionic surfactant mixtures and octyldodecylmyristate using the phase transition low-energy emulsification method. The nano-emulsions were formed only in the very narrow area of the concentration of mixed surfactant and oil molar ratio of around 1 : 1. The particle size of the emulsions was decreased as adding the aqueous phase into the emulsions after phase inversion point unlike the emulsions formed only with nonionic surfactant. Nano-emulsion was stable at room temperature for more than a month. Thus, the nano-emulsions containing phospholipids can be widely used as a cosmetic formulations.

  • In this study, we prepared liquid crystal emulsion composed of amphiphilic substance $C_{14-22}$ alcohol, $C_{12-20}$ alkyl glucoside, behenyl alcohol and studied liquid crystal emulsion of properties and in vitro skin permeation. The results of formulation experiments, the clear liquid crystalline structure was observed in the ratio of $C_{14-22}$ alcohol 0.8%, $C_{12-20}$ alkyl glucoside 3.2%, behenyl alcohol 4% in the formulation. The results of physical property measurements, the viscosity of liquid crystal emulsion and O/W emulsion applied as a control group was respectively $1871.26{\sim}1.15Pa{\cdot}s$, $1768.69{\sim}1.14Pa{\cdot}s$ and the shear stress of O/W emulsion was 178.68 ~ 909.18 Pa, that of liquid crystal emulsion was 190.45 ~ 919.38 Pa. The storage modulus of O/W emulsion was 3428.53 ~ 9157.45 Pa, that of liquid crystal emulsion was 4487.82 ~ 8195.59 Pa. The tan (delta) value of O/W emulsion which means a ratio of viscosity to elasticity was 0.43 ~ 0.19, and that of liquid crystal emulsion was 0.23 ~ 0.25. The water content value on the skin for liquid crystal emulsion was significantly higher from 1 h to 6 h compared with that of O/W emulsion and the transepidermal water loss on the skin was significantly superior in skin moisture loss suppression from 30 min to 4 h compared with that of O/W emulsion. The results of skin permeation using glycyrrhizic acid, the result of skin permeation amount of liquid crystal emulsion for 24 h was $64.58{\mu}g/cm^2$, that of O/W emulsion was $37.07{\mu}g/cm^2$, that of butylene glycol solution was $41.05{\mu}g/cm^2$. Hourly permeability results, it is showed that skin penetration effect of the liquid crystal emulsion increases after 8 h. These results suggest that liquid crystal emulsions are effective for skin moisturizing effect and function as potential efficacy ingredient delivery system for the transdermal delivery.

  • The objective of this study is to analyze the influences of fatty alcohols and fatty acids on rheological properties of oil in water (O/W) emulsions using viscosity and rheograms. As the chain length of fatty alcohols and fatty acids lengthened, the viscosity of emulsions was increased. The influence of fatty alcohols on viscosity enhancement was stronger than that of fatty acids. Both stearyl alcohol and cetearyl alcohol, which have carbon chain length similar to lipophilic portion of surfactant used in emulsion preparation, had showed the best increase in viscosity of O/W emulsions. O/W emulsions prepared with fatty alcohols and fatty acids were pseudo-plastic fluid and they showed shear thinning behaviour like as the common cosmetic emulsions. O/W emulsions prepared with cetyl alcohol, cetearyl alcohol and stearyl alcohol were thixotropic fluids and thixotropy increased with an increase in the concentration of fatty alcohols and fatty acids. Also O/W emulsions prepared with fatty alcohols were more thixotropic than those prepared with fatty acids. For the sake of viscosity increase related to O/W emulsions stability and spreadability enhancement related to payoff, it is thought that fatty alcohols are more useful than fatty acids in the O/W emulsions as the emulsion stabilizer.

  • 한외여과분리의 중요한 응용분야의 하나인 oil/water 에멀젼의 분리에 대하여 연구하였다. Oil/water 에멀젼의 한외여과분리 원리를 제안하고, 상용되고 있는 하나의 절삭유를 대상으로 분리가능성을 조사하였다. 사용된 한외여과분리 모듈은 상업적으로 이용되고 있는 IRIS 3042 분리막이 장착된 평판형이었다. 한외여과 실험에서 공급압력, 공급유량, 공급에멀젼의 oil농도등을 변화시키면서 투과액의 oil농도, 투과속도등을 측정하여 분리성능을 조사하였다.

  • Polyurethane acrylate hybrid emulsions were prepared by seeded polymerization techniques. In the synthesis, seeded polyurethane dispersion containing a carboxylic group was used to endow hydrophilicity to the hybrid emulsion and various acrylates such as methyl methacrylate (MMA), 2-hydroxy ethylmethacrylate (2-HEMA), n-butyl acrylate (n-BA) and acrylic acid (AAc) were used to endow hydrophobicity. The particle size and distribution of various emulsion particles such as polyurethane acrylate hybrid emulsion, polyurethane dispersion homopolymer, acrylate emulsion, and physical blending emulsion were measured by a particle size analyzer. The average particle size of hybrid emulsion was greater than physical blending emulsion. And tensile strength, 100% modulus, elongation, and swelling properties of the polyurethane acrylate hybrid emulsion were studied and compared with those of polyurethane homopolymer, acrylate emulsion, and physically blended compositor, respectively. To improve chemical and physical resistance, this paper review a melamine hardener and compares it for effects on the physical properties of cured coating.

  • In this study, we tried the various experiments using the emulsifier, electrolyte, stabilizer and gelling agent in order to improve a stability of low viscosity W/O emulsion. As a result, when we used polyglyceryl-4 diisostearate/polyhydroxystearate/sebacate as a main emulsifier, PEG-30 dipolyhydroxystearate and cetyl PEG/PPG-10/1 dimethicone as a co-emulsifier for stable emulsification system, 0.5 % sodium chloride as an electrolyte, 1 % distearyldimonium chloride as a stabilizer, 0.5 % glyceryl behenate/eicosadioate as an oil gelling agent, emulsion particle is the best. Also, we got the stable and low viscosity W/O emulsion maintained at a constant viscosity at 2,000 cps or less. In addition, we were able to examine the possibility of development of low viscosity fluids type sunscreens with excellent feeling and stability through the application of inorganic sunscreen agents.
